Miami is the most “forgetful” city in the US, with passengers leaving more personal belongings behind in Ubers than residents anywhere else, according to a new study.

The eighth annual Uber Lost & Found Index lists the most forgetful cities, the items most frequently left in Ubers, as well as some of the most unique belongings passengers have forgotten. The Index also reached a few conclusions: The most forgetful day of the year is January 21, and the time most people report leaving items behind is between 9 p.m. and 10 p.m. And you might be surprised to hear that the the most popular color of lost items is red.

While Miami tops the list of the most forgetful cities, two other Florida cities made the top 10: Orlando came in at 6th place, and Tampa Bay ranked eighth.

The 10 most commonly forgotten items:

  1. Clothing
  2. Luggage 
  3. Headphones 
  4. Wallet 
  5. Jewelry 
  6. Phone
  7. Camera
  8. Tablet or book
  9. Laptop
  10. Vape 

The 10 most forgetful cities:

  1. Miami
  2. Los Angeles
  3. Atlanta
  4. Houston
  5. Dallas
  6. Orlando
  7. Phoenix
  8. Tampa Bay
  9. Denver
  10. Austin
